Ideally we would like to hire two students to start during the summer and possibly two more students to start in the Fall semester. The Innovation Center (IC), located at 340. W. State Street is part of Ohio University’s entrepreneurial ecosystem and the university-wide initiative to encourage and support economic development through entrepreneurship and small business support. In its 36,000 square foot facility, the IC nurtures startup companies, providing them with the space, services, and resources necessary to launch and grow. Most of the Southeast Ohio region’s major employers have benefitted from assistance from the IC. The IC has a long tradition of excellence and has been recognized for its work. In 2015, the IC was ranked the third best university-based incubator in the U.S.; in 2016, it was named Rural Incubator of the Year; in 2019, it was named the Incubator of the Year; and, in 2022, it was again named the Rural Incubator of the Year.
